Is zoology and animal biology the same?

As a branch of biology, zoology studies structure, embryology, evolution, classification, habits, and distribution of any and all animals, regardless of whether they are living or extinct. ... Zoology degrees are conferred at the baccalaureate, master's and PhD levels.

Do zoologists only study animals?

Zoologists usually specialize in studying either vertebrate or invertebrate animals. Once they have made that decision, they can become an expert in a particular species. There are roughly 10 main specializations for zoologists. Cetologists study marine mammals such as whales and dolphins.

What's the study of animals?

Zoology (/zoʊˈɒlədʒi/) is the branch of biology that studies the animal kingdom, including the structure, embryology, evolution, classification, habits, and distribution of all animals, both living and extinct, and how they interact with their ecosystems.

Is zoology part of biology?

zoology, branch of biology that studies the members of the animal kingdom and animal life in general.

Is a zoologist a biologist?

What Zoologists and Wildlife Biologists Do. ... Zoologists and wildlife biologists study animals and other wildlife and how they interact with their ecosystems.

What's the difference between a biologist and a zoologist?

Zoologists and wildlife biologists are both scientists who study animal life, but these career paths have a few important differences. Zoologists study animals while wildlife biologists study how animals interact with their environments.

What do zoology majors do?

A zoology major studies wild or domesticated animals and how they are shaped by their environments and relationships. Students on this path, which may also be called an animal biology major, may go on to conduct field research or pursue higher education in veterinary sciences or medicine.

What is Zoology subject?

Zoology is a branch of biology which specializes in the study of animals both living and extinct, including their anatomy and physiology, embryology, genetics, evolution, classification, habits, behavior and distribution.
